Charlie Hall Chase
With the participation of short priced favourite Bravemansgame currently in doubt, it looks worth backing GENTLEMANSGAME (best priced at 15/2) for the Charlie Hall Chase on Saturday. The Mouse Morris trained seven-year-old has the benefit of race-fitness over all of his rivals other than Aye Right who was beaten in a veterans’ handicap on his reappearance with the selection finishing a close 2nd behind Easy Game in the Grade 2 PWC Champion Chase a month ago.
Gentlesmansgame beat the subsequent Irish Grand National winner I Am Maximus by eight lengths on his chasing debut in December on soft ground before missing the remainder of his novice campaign. He jumped well but looked outpaced over 2m4f at Gowran Park last time shaping like this step up to 3 miles will suit him well. Ahoy Senor also has the option of the bet365 Hurdle earlier on the card so this race could cut up further come declaration time and I expect Gentlemansgame to be a lot shorter than the current odds that are available. The selection still has a stone to find on official ratings but he is unexposed and deserves to take his chance in this race.
